'Dormant' Summary
E. Nesbit's 'Dormant' is a gothic novel that explores the complexities of love, wealth, and hidden secrets. The story begins with a group of seven friends navigating the early stages of their lives, their destinies intertwined. Among them, Rose, a gifted artist, and Anthony, a brilliant chemist, find themselves drawn to each other. Their relationship takes a dramatic turn when Anthony unexpectedly inherits a large fortune and a mysterious secret. The sudden influx of wealth brings about a dramatic change in their lives, introducing elements of suspense and a looming sense of danger. As the friends navigate their newfound circumstances, they must unravel the secrets of the past to protect their relationships and their very lives. The novel masterfully intertwines themes of love, betrayal, and the corrosive nature of wealth, culminating in a thrilling climax that tests the strength of their friendships and leaves the reader pondering the true cost of ambition and hidden desires. 'Dormant' is a captivating gothic tale that explores the dark undercurrents that can lie beneath the surface of seemingly idyllic lives.Book Details
